  • METHODOLOGICAL APPROACHES OF ANDRAGOGY IN THE TEACHING SYSTEM OF PEDAGOGICAL UNIVERSITY

    Greta Hakobyan
    Abstract

    Adult education in the current changing political, economic, socio-cultural, demographic shifts becomes a possible condition for their self-realization, professional development and self-establishment.

    The aim of the research is to reveal the socio-pedagogical features of the educational process of adult students studying in the distance learning system of the Pedagogical University through a sociological survey based on studies dedicated to andragogy.

    The scientific novelty of the study lies in the fact that, from the point of view of modernity, the factors influencing the education of adults in a pedagogical university are presented in a new way, their socio-pedagogical and psychological characteristics are described, and methodological approaches to the effective implementation of this process are noted.

    The analysis of the research results, data processing and their evaluation allows to make the following conclusions:

    • In order to study the educational needs of adult students, it is necessary to use research tools such as oral-written surveys, discussions, self-assessment scales, essays, analysis and evaluation of the results of various surveys.
    • Overcoming the difficulties encountered in working with ICT requires solving a number of organizational-psychological problems.
    • Learners generally do not experience psychological difficulties in interpersonal communication with younger students, they are often more active and encouraged by the supportive attitude of teachers.
    • Their professional and social experience should be taken into account when organizing the education of adult students.

    In further studies on the research issue, it is necessary to take into account the priorities of the organization of professional education for adult students to ensure the development of professional competencies, which in turn will meet the educational needs of modern society, social movements, labor market requirements, socio-economic, scientific and cultural developments.
